A leading disability-focused charity in the UK is looking for a Head of Finance to lead its finance function and support strategic decision-making. This role includes responsibilities such as managing budgeting, forecasting, cash flow management, and ensuring strong financial control.

The ideal candidate will have a professional accountancy qualification and senior experience in finance leadership.

The position offers 27 days holiday, hybrid working options, and excellent career development opportunities.
